#2d7e12 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d7e12 is composed of 17.6% red, 49.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.7%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 105 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 28.2%. #2d7e12 color hex could be obtained by blending #5afc24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#2d7e12

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d7e12

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464c44 is the less saturated color, while #258f01 is the most saturated one.
